Commit | Line | Data |
b974984a |
1 | package # hide from PAUSE |
2 | DBICTest::Schema::SequenceTest; |
3 | |
4 | use base qw/DBICTest::BaseResult/; |
5 | |
6 | __PACKAGE__->table('sequence_test'); |
7 | __PACKAGE__->source_info({ |
8 | "source_info_key_A" => "source_info_value_A", |
9 | "source_info_key_B" => "source_info_value_B", |
10 | "source_info_key_C" => "source_info_value_C", |
11 | "source_info_key_D" => "source_info_value_D", |
12 | }); |
13 | __PACKAGE__->add_columns( |
14 | 'pkid1' => { |
15 | data_type => 'integer', |
16 | auto_nextval => 1, |
17 | sequence => 'pkid1_seq', |
18 | }, |
19 | 'pkid2' => { |
20 | data_type => 'integer', |
21 | auto_nextval => 1, |
22 | sequence => 'pkid2_seq', |
23 | }, |
24 | 'nonpkid' => { |
25 | data_type => 'integer', |
26 | auto_nextval => 1, |
27 | sequence => 'nonpkid_seq', |
28 | }, |
29 | 'name' => { |
30 | data_type => 'varchar', |
31 | size => 100, |
32 | is_nullable => 1, |
33 | }, |
34 | ); |
35 | __PACKAGE__->set_primary_key('pkid1', 'pkid2'); |
36 | |
37 | 1; |